How they compare
Colombia currently reports 289,295 children against 213,285 children in Benin, a difference of 76,010 children.
That makes Colombia's figure about 1.4 times Benin's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 15 shared years of data; in 2004 it was Benin ahead.
Benin ranks 36th and Colombia ranks 33rd of 196 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Benin averaged higher in 2 and Colombia in 1.
